1. An implantable medical device (IMD) for operating in a modified impedance mode, comprising:

  • a stimulation unit to provide an electrical stimulation signal through a lead operatively coupled to said IMD; and

    a controller comprisinga signal detection unit to receive an indication selected from the group consisting of an indication of the presence of a radio frequency (RF) coupled energy on said lead and an indication of the future presence of said RF coupled energy on said lead, andan impedance unit to modify an impedance of said lead based upon said indication received by said signal detection unit, wherein said impedance unit comprises;

    at least one of a capacitive impedance, an inductive impedance, a resistive impedance, a short-circuit, and an open circuit;

    a switching network capable of switching at least one of said capacitive impedance, inductive impedance, resistive impedance, said open circuit, and said short circuit to modify said impedance of said lead; and

    an active cancellation unit, configured to provide upon the lead a controlled current signal for actively reducing said coupled energy.
